2013-11-25 46 views
0

林设计网站标志2012 ASP.NET MVC4对齐与使用Visual Studio的ASP.NET MVC 4输入字段使用引导

而且它应该是这样的


default1


,但它竟然是这样


![默认设置2] [2]


我需要用用户名密码&领域对准标志,这些领域应该有之间的空间。顺便说一句,我使用最新版本的Twitter Bootstrap作为我的CSS。感谢您的帮助!

此外,这些是我的代码。

<header class="navbar navbar-inverse" role="banner"> 
      <div class="container"> 
       <img src="@Url.Content("~/Content/img/Logo-Sample.png")" alt="Image" id="logo" class="img-responsive"/> 
          <div class="pull-right"> 

           <form class="navbar-form pull-right" role="form"> 

          <div class="form-group"> 
           <input type="email" class="form-control" id="exampleInputEmail2" placeholder="Username"> 
          </div> 

          <div class="form-group"> 
           <input type="password" class="form-control" id="exampleInputPassword2" placeholder="Password"> 
          </div> 
          <div class="checkbox"> 
           <label> 
            <input type="checkbox"> Remember me 
           </label> 
          </div> 
           <button type="submit" class="btn btn-default">Sign in</button> 
           </form> 
          </div>    
       </div> 






    </header> 

更新:

我申请雷恩的建议“浮动的东西”,而现在,LOGO与输入字段内联。

enter image description here

但输入外地去向上而不是向下。对此有何建议?谢谢!

回答

0

所以它看起来像你的标志和登录部分都是块级元素。他们需要内嵌块或者其中一个需要适当地向左或向右浮动。

就用于登录块的元素之间的空间...我会做一个CSS选择器来匹配标题登录输入元素,并为它们添加一些保证金。

+0

你好,我有你的想法应用浮法。我将徽标向左侧漂浮,然后就这样了。现在我的困境是输入字段没有按照要求很好地对齐。非常感谢你的帮助! – LYKS

0

有时HTML格式非常挑剔。但是,打开asp文件的标记并在这些输入区域的标记之间放置一个空格,或者在占位符后面放置一个尾随。对于稍微高一些的人,我忘记了我正在寻找的单词,但是它的东西有点像一张桌子,让它们都在那一排的插槽中。看看我在试图说什么,因为我完全忘了这个词。 (如果我记得我回来并编辑这个)

+0

谢谢你的想法。我已经尝试使用行,但它仍然是这样。 – LYKS